Transaction 142bc28b37fefd0f5d679d5898d531dcf05a888f6f3c19bcd06a27d4acaacfda

1 Input
2 Outputs
  • 142bc28b37fefd0f5d679d5898d531dcf05a888f6f3c19bcd06a27d4acaacfda:0
  • value  21976304
    address  17oSJBxS1avwkir55h3ovBGUwajPLXqE2f
  • 142bc28b37fefd0f5d679d5898d531dcf05a888f6f3c19bcd06a27d4acaacfda:1
  • value  5500000
    address  1JHsi7fnpk1GEEdbq9ms2B5iFw2V6UmJk4